Web10 de sept. de 2024 · The heat will always flow from hot to cold objects since when the particles move, they will transfer some of their kinetic energy to other particles through collision. This is the reason why hot objects feel hot and cold objects feel cold. If you hold a cup of hot tea, the cup will transfer heat into your hands. WebWhen the two systems are in contact, heat will be transferred through molecular collisions from the hotter system to the cooler system. The thermal energy will flow in that direction until the two objects are at the same temperature. When the two systems in contact are at the same temperature, we say they are in thermal equilibrium.
